    FICA payments
    An Algerian national with US citizenship (duel citizenship). He was recruited and employed by the Algerian branch office of a US company. In the eyes of the Algerian labor authorities the employee is a local Algerian hire and therefore the U.S. company’s branch office has been withholding and paying local taxes and social security (social health) on the employee’s behalf. The employee has been filing a U.S. tax return since returning to Algeria from the U.S. five years ago. The employee has also been making annual 15+% FICA payments with each tax return. There is no tax treaty between the US and Algeria. What obligation does the employer have in making FICA payments on the employee’s behalf?
